But that's you, and look where you're posting.

Most non-comics fans weren't very familiar with most of those Marvel characters before the movies. People know that Superman is Clark Kent, loves Lois, and that he fights Lex Luthor, and people know about rich guy Bruce Wayne who dresses like a bat and fights clowns with the Batmobile and various gadgets. But they didn't know about Tony Stark and Iron Man. They might have been generally familiar with Cap, but only as a guy with a shield and not that he's Steve Rogers, a laboratory-created super-soldier from WWII. They didn't know who Nick Fury is, or about Hawkeye or Black Widow.

Give Marvel credit...they elevated those characters. They had to, because they didn't have Spidey or Wolverine. And that's why they had to do all the introductory origin films, and WB doesn't.
